ToggleThe Mukhyamantri Kanya Bibaha Yojana (MKBY) is a flagship initiative by the Odisha government to support the marriage of girls from economically weaker families. Announced by Chief Minister Mohan Charan Majhi in the 2025-26 budget, the scheme provides financial assistance and promotes gender equality while combating child marriage. 1. Scheme Overview
- Objective: Reduce financial burdens on BPL families, prevent child marriages, and empower girls through education and dignified marriages .
- Financial Assistance: ₹25,000 per beneficiary, transferred directly to the bride’s Aadhaar-linked bank account via DBT .
- Target Group: Girls from BPL families in Odisha, with marriages conducted through government-organized mass ceremonies .
- Additional Benefits: Subsidized wedding essentials (e.g., sarees, utensils) and optional use of funds for education or small business setups .
2. Eligibility Criteria
To qualify, applicants must meet the following:
- Residency: Bride must be a permanent resident of Odisha.
- Economic Status: Family must hold a valid BPL ration card .
- Age: Bride ≥ 18 years, groom ≥ 21 years at the time of marriage .
- Marriage Type: First legal marriage of the girl, registered under Odisha Marriage Registration Rules .
3. Required Documents
Applicants must submit:
- BPL ration card (proof of economic status).
- Bride’s age proof (birth certificate/Aadhaar).
- Residence certificate.
- Bride’s bank account details (Aadhaar-linked).
- Marriage registration certificate .
4. Application Process
The process is offline and involves three steps:
Step 1: Document Submission
- Visit the nearest Block Development Office (BDO) or Anganwadi center.
- Submit the required documents listed above .
Step 2: Verification
- Authorities verify eligibility, age, and marriage authenticity.
- Field checks may be conducted to prevent fraud .
Step 3: Fund Disbursement
- After successful verification, ₹25,000 is transferred to the bride’s bank account via DBT .
5. Key Features & Impact
- Child Marriage Reduction: Targets Odisha’s 20.5% child marriage rate (NFHS-5) by enforcing the legal age .
- Social Empowerment: Promotes gender equality and links financial aid to educational milestones .
- Transparency: Digital tracking ensures accountability and minimizes corruption .
6. Challenges & Considerations
- Awareness: Rural outreach is critical for maximum participation .
- Post-Marriage Support: Skill development programs are recommended for long-term empowerment .
